By LCDR
Mick Gallagher and Raveena Carroll
It was a case of mother like daughter when SBLT Sophie
White graduated from the New Entry Officer Course 27 (NEOC 27) at
HMAS Creswell.
SBLT Whites mother is the Honourable Justice Margaret White,
a Justice of the Supreme Court of Queensland. To the RAN, she is
CMDR White, a recent Legal Officer recruit to the Navy Reserve.
Sophies father is Dr Michael White QC, the Executive Director
of the Centre for Maritime Law at the University of Queensland and
a former navy commander.
Both parents were present to see their daughter graduate in a traditional
passing out parade at the College.
The past six months have tested me mentally and physically
and I feel a sense of achievement in having completed my naval officer
training, said SBLT White.
The CO of Creswell, CAPT Andrew Cawley, said each of the 57 officers
who graduated should be proud of their achievement in completing
NEOC 27.
The aim of the course was to give each of the new officers
the skills and training they will need to become leaders within
the RAN. For many of the trainees this was their first experience
of Navy life and customs, and that in itself was a great learning
experience.
I wish each and every one of them continued success throughout
their Navy careers, said CAPT Cawley.
